Agia Galini is one of the most popular tourist resorts in the Rethymno region. Located 56 km southeast of the city, the area¢s infrastructure rivals that of any modern holiday destination. Large hotel complexes, luxurious studios, and a variety of entertainment and activity options meet the needs of every visitor.
According to local tradition, the area¢s name comes from a vow made by Byzantine Empress Eudokia. It is said that while traveling, she was caught in a storm at sea and prayed to the Virgin Mary to calm the waters. Her prayer was answered, and the place where the storm subsided was named Agia Galini, meaning “Saint Serenity.”
In the picturesque harbor of Agia Galini, you can enjoy romantic walks amidst stunning natural surroundings, while the area¢s dreamy beaches offer opportunities for swimming and practicing water sports.
The main beach of Agia Galini is known for its shallow, warm waters. Nearby, on the road to the village of Krya Vrysi, lies the stunning sandy beach of Agios Pavlos. We recommend swimming in one of the small, secluded beaches formed by rocks and sand dunes—a truly unique experience.
